Abstract
1. A cylindrical or polygonal moulding of graphite and nickel sulphide for the safe long-term containment of spent nuclear fuel rods in the original form or in a shaped form thereof, characterised in that it contains anchoring plates (1) in the top- (2) and bottom-region (3) and contains metal rods (4) which are fixed in the anchoring plates (1) in the nuclear fuel rod-free zones in the interior parallel to the main axis of the moulding.
